Commercial Description:
Brewed with pale and special caramel malt, hops imported from Southern Germany, fine Ale yeast and pure water from the Mountains near Valdivia. This beer of Super Premium character has a great aroma and leaves in the mouth a fine smokey sensation. (Translation by Panzerfaust).

(Bottle). Clear amber colour with a firm medium head. Deep aroma of caramel malt, some honey, candy, and grains. Flavor is mainly strong and malty, also slightly sweet, fruity and alcoholic. Medium body and average carbonation, slick texture. Bitter end. It’s a excellent strong ale made in Chile, very different from the Torobayo.

Draught at the brew pub, a dark reddish copper with a filmy beige head. A slightly metallic but sweet aroma with some grainy malt and toasted caramal. A smooth palate with a medium mouthfeel. Good alcohol presence, increasing with the swallow and imparting syrupy medicinal flavours along with caramal malt. Tangy in the finish.
